    The seat distribution with respect to  different branches in NMIT is as follows:

    Computer science and engineering 180

    Electronics and clmmunication engineerinh180

    Information science and engineering 180

    Mechanical engineering 180

    Civil engineering 120

    Aeronautical engineering 60

    Electrical and electronics engineering 60.

    College Infrastructure

    We have very good infrastructure without a civil department, having well-equipped labs and machinery. Hostel facility is good but not great and the quality of food in mess is good with many varieties and the canteen price is quite expensive. We have well-equipped medical assistance. NITTE is a very good supportive of sports and games

    Teachers are well-qualified and knowledgeable. They share emerging knowledge with the students, which is understandable and very effective. The course curriculum is relevant, but it goes away with some subjects that are not required. Semester exams are a bit difficult in order to maintain the respective pattern and level of exams. Pass percentage is about 30 to 35%.
